Disabilities Services Funding

Dáil Éireann Debate, Wednesday - 16 October 2013

Wednesday, 16 October 2013

Questions (153)

Robert Troy

Question:

153. Deputy Robert Troy asked the Minister for Health if he will ensure that there are no more budget cuts to the intellectual disability budget this year as this sector is simply unable to withstand further cuts and needs to be protected and supported. [43779/13]

View answer

Written answers

The level of funding available for the health budget and the extent of the savings required in the health sector are being considered as part of the estimates and budgetary process for 2014 which is currently underway. Pending completion of the national estimates, budgetary and service planning process for 2014 it is not possible to predict the service levels to be provided next year for the disability sector.
